Minutes — Management Meeting (Sales Leads)

Topic: Q3 Budget Request

Denna presented the ask: extra headcount for the Larkspur accounts and a bump to the travel line. Finance pushed back a bit on the events spend, so we trimmed it. Revised figures go to Orvan by Friday. Sales leads should hold commitments until sign-off. The thinking behind the reallocation is set out below.

internal memo for haduf-fajeg: Headcount on the Quenwyn team goes from 7 to 80 by the end of July. Gross margin on Quenwyn came in at 10 percent against a plan of 15 percent.

Internal Memo — Brackenfold Foods

To: Sales Leads

The franchise agreement with Tarlowe Hospitality Group was signed Tuesday, covering twelve outlets across the Merrivale region. Standard royalty terms apply; territory exclusivity holds for three years. Please direct all franchise inquiries to the partnerships desk and avoid quoting terms independently. Further expansion intentions are set out in the confidential note that follows.

confidential, fafog-fafog: Only 21 of the 82 pilot accounts renewed Holwyn, so a churn review is set for September 1. Normirox Logistics is in early talks to buy Praiusox Foods for about $134.2 million.

Subject: Key-card stock — Ellsworth Quay site

Dispatch,

Two sealed boxes of blank key-cards for the new Ellsworth Quay site are staged on shelf D-12. Courier from Tarnley Secure collects tomorrow between 09:00 and 10:00, bay 1. Boxes must stay sealed and travel together. Log the waybill as usual. For the hand-over itself, apply the confidential instruction noted directly below this line.

drop instructions, yafog-yawip: the quenmir olidor courier leaves the julox tamion keliel ledger at gate 5283 under passcode 336825

### Key Ceremony Checklist — Item 7: Bulk-Edit Lockdown

Before the ceremony begins, confirm that bulk edits in the Registry admin table are frozen. Open the Wardenline console, verify the bulk-edit toggle reads DISABLED, and record the timestamp in the ceremony log. If the toggle is stuck or the console refuses your role, use the emergency override. The override prompt accepts the recovery passphrase below.

strongbox words: briiel-zoreth-noveth-pelys-druwyn-feniel-lamvan-ulaius-kasion